Lots of folks like to **** on TAPCO (even me from time to time) but I'm a fan of their G2 AK trigger and their mags have always functioned fine in my rifles but seemed to have one problem---they'd break. Each time it was the locking lug but unfortunately I didn't do reviews back in those days and have no footage of it. So, I decided to try to test these mags on film and here's what I found:

Pros:
-Reliable. As stated above, I never had function issues with TAPCO AK mags.
-Cheap. If you follow the deals these mags can sometimes be had for $6-9/ea
-They count as 3x 922r parts and are made in the USA
-TAPCO has always stood behind their no questions asked warranty in my experience.
-The texture of the mags provides a good gripping surface when removing from a pouch/pocket.


Cons:
-No metal lining or reinforcements.

Here's a video with some shooting, multiple drop tests of both the '47 and '74 variants, an overview of the mags, a dirt test, and a short diatribe of what I think of them overall:

Excellent video! Thanks for making it. I like Tapco AK magazines. They're cheap, perfectly durable enough for 99.95% of all shooters in the USA, and in my experience, 100% reliable. Even after having some mud slapped into it, inserted into the gun, and then covering the whole everything in mud. I broke a feed lip after I threw it, fully loaded with 30 rounds of 7.62x39, about 10 feet into the air to land on a large rock. It still fed in my AMD-65 despite the broken feed lip (there was enough of it left to secure the rounds). I told Tapco what happened and they sent me a new one without any hesitation even though it was purposely damaged. They're a good company. And on a side note, their G2 trigger group is absolutely fantastic. Their 14x1LH threaded muzzle devices are nice too.
